3 About Paper 3.1 About Paper Using unsuitable paper may lead to paper jams, poor print quality, breakdown and damage to your printer. In order to use the features of this printer effectively, we suggest using only paper that is recommended here. When you use paper that is not recommended, contact our Printer Support Desk. Usable Paper The types of paper that can be used on this printer are as follows. When printing on paper that is commonly sold, use the types of paper in the following table. However, it is recommended to use paper in the next category, standard paper for clearer printing. Paper tray Size Weight Loading Capacity Tray 1 Standard sizes that can be automatically detected: A5 , B5 , A4 , Executive (7.25 × 10.5") , Letter (8.5 × 11") , Legal (8.5 × 13") , Legal (8.5 × 14") 60 - 216 g/m2 (16 - 57.5 lb) 150 sheets (P paper) or 17. 5 mm or below Tray 2 to 4 (tray 3 and 4 are optional) Others: A6 *1, COM-10 Envelope*1, Monarch Envelope*1, DL Envelope*1, C5 Envelope*1 Custom*2 (76 × 127 - 216 × 900*3 mm) Standard sizes that can be automatically detected: A5 , B5 , A4 , Executive (7.25 × 10.5") , Letter (8. 5 × 11") , Legal (8. 5 × 13") , Legal (8. 5 × 14") 60 - 216 g/m2 (16 - 57.5 lb) 250-sheet tray: 250 sheets (P paper) or 27.6 mm or below 550-sheet tray: 550 sheets (P paper) or 59.4 mm or below Others: A6 *1, COM-10 Envelope*1, Monarch Envelope*1, DL Envelope*1, C5 Envelope*1 Custom*2 (98 × 148 - 216 × 356 mm) *1: Requires the paper size settings be done on the control panel. *2: Requires the paper size settings be done on the control panel and the printer driver. *3: Print quality on the part of the paper that extends beyond 356 mm cannot be guaranteed. Important • Printing on paper whose setting is different from the paper size or paper type selected on the printer driver or loading paper into an unsuitable paper tray for printing may lead to paper jams. To ensure printing is correctly done, select the correct paper size, paper type, and paper tray. • The printed image may fade due to moisture such as water, rain or vapor. For details, contact our Printer Support Desk. 3.1 About Paper 43
